Tips to raise a student's confidence before a math exam
Chat along with your classmates
Knowing how your classmates are doing will help you in many ways. Simply discussing that newly learned basic fraction concept or that right triangle question with another 6th grade math student would help knowing about it.
Ask other students if you feel confused. When you are unclear about a fairly easy algebra equation or perhaps an inequality with absolute value, asking other math students will help you understand. Learning from your classmates is the foremost way, since adult explanations will often be complex and, sometimes, superfluous.

Actively asking the questions you have can help reduce your inner anxiety. Simply understanding that other 6th grade math students surrounding you care about your learning helps to inspire you and boosts your math confidence. No longer when you think that math can be a dry and lonesome subject.

Start a habit of completing all homework assignments and checking them
There is surely an nugget of advice the work you spend equals how much reward you get out. Middle school math follows the identical concept. 6th grade math students should allot time in your own home to practice homework problems.
Early on in elementary school, there might 't be math homework for majority of the week. But, middle school math covers a broader scope of info to ensure middle school math teachers assign more homework problems.
6th grade math students should find a habit of putting aside a great amount of time everyday to accomplish math homework. At first, the increasing quantity of math homework problems might seem daunting.
I remember simply how much I had protested for playtime in doing my early middle school years... My father and mother would pay attention to me but explain exactly how important completing my math homework is.
Missing a short time might not an issue, nevertheless it hurts in the long run. If you do not create a proper doing-math-homework time, then, almost certainly than not, you will never be able to atone for or understand new math materials.
Seeing other 6th grade math students succeed while you fall behind depletes your math confidence.
Through continuous practice of people math homework problems, you'll solve similar math problems more quickly. Speed matters most on receiving a high score on your own math test. Prepare early for math tests. Study small chunks of math materials/notes every day.
Studying requires the proper distribution of training. No one can learn and understand all things in a matter of minutes. Simply put, I have never met a good middle school math student who crams for an exam. Cramming is definitely an ineffective study technique. Middle school math students who cram for a math test cannot commit the primary algebra equations or geometry formulas inside their memory.
Ineffective memorization returns to haunt the students later on. They will have trouble recalling what they have learned on cumulative math exams or perhaps in higher-level math courses. Persistent cramming can increase the math students' stress and panic. Not willing to alter their studying techniques, these middle school math students feel more pressured in studying and less confident to perform well.
